Skripta treba da radi sledece (jedna ili vise njih sve jedno)
Dakle postoji vise fajlova flat text baza podataka
svi oni treba da se sloze u jednu veliku. E ali
ti fajlovi mogu da se menjaju (korisnici ih uploaduju)
Trebalo bi da radim spajanje u tu veliku bazu svaki
put kada bilo koji korisnik postavi novu verziju svoje baze
[tako je baza uvek azurna]
Kako da izvedem sistem zakljucavanja/cekanja ?
scenario: korisnik 1 postavio novu bazu, krece pravljenje
glavne baze, i na pola toga korisnik 2 postavi
svoju bazu .... naravno skripta obrise sadrzaj
baze i krece ispocetka ali se prva jos uvek
izvrsava ... itd
dakle neki flock() cini mi se ? Jer moze nekako preko chmod-a ?
I kako pre otvaranja da proverim dali je zakljucan fajl
(i da ceka dok se ne otkljuca) ?
Ako neko ima bolju ideju za sam sistem neka javi .... imam i ja samo
memuci jos par sitnica a ovako samo da radi neko vreme da imam
sta da pokazem :)